AI-powered predictive analytics Robotics in warehousing and logistics Supply Chain Resilience and Risk Management The COVID-19 pandemic highlighted the vulnerability of global supply chains. In 2025, businesses will prioritize resilience by diversifying their supply sources and increasing transparency across the supply chain. Real-time data and advanced analytics will play a crucial role in identifying potential risks, enabling companies to respond quickly to disruptions. Enhanced risk management strategies will focus on building more adaptable and resilient supply chains that can withstand economic, geopolitical, and environmental shocks.
